.bgcolor {
	background-color: #0A2552;
}
.bodytext {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 11px;
	color: #333333;
	background-color: #FFFFFF;
	padding-left: 25px;
	padding-right: 60px;
	padding-bottom: 0px;
	background-position: top;
}
.bodytext_ {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 11px;
	color: #287441;
	background-color: #FFFFFF;
	
	background-position: top;
}
.bodytext2 {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 10px;
	color: #333333;
	background-color: #FFFFFF;
	text-align: center;
}
.bodytext3 {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 11px;
	color: #333333;
	background-color: #FFFFFF;
	padding-top: 45px;
	padding-left: 0px;
	padding-right: 80px;
	padding-bottom: 10px;
	background-position: top;
	
}
.bodytext4 {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 11px;
	color: #333333;
	background-color: #FFFFFF;
	padding-top: 20px;
	padding-left: 15px;
	padding-right: 15px;
	padding-bottom: 10px;
	background-position: top;
	text-align: left;
	left: 20px;
	}
.bodytext5 {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 11px;
	color: #333333;
	background-color: #FFFFFF;
	padding-top: 4px;
	padding-bottom: 10px;
	padding-left: 20px;
	padding-right: 20px;
	background-position: top;
	border-left-style: dotted;
	border-left-width: thin;
	border-left-color: #333333;
	text-align: left;	
}
a:link {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	text-decoration: none;
	color: #333333;
}
a:visited {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	color: #333333;
	text-decoration: none;
}

a:hover {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	text-decoration: underline;
	color: #333333;	
}
.line {
	border-top-width: 1px;
	border-top-style: dotted;
	border-top-color: #333333;
}
.line_ {
	border-top-width: 1px;
	border-top-style: dotted;
	border-top-color: #003366;
}
.line_i {
	border-top-width: 1px;
	border-top-style: dotted;
	border-top-color: #0A2552;
}

.line_p {
	border-top-width: 1px;
	border-top-style: dotted;
	border-top-color: #E76B20;
	
}
.line_w {
	border-top-width: 1px;
	border-top-style: dotted;
	border-top-color: #287441;
}

.line_s {
	border-top-width: 1px;
	border-top-style: dotted;
	border-top-color: #C6CA47;
}

.line_t {
	border-top-width: 1px;
	border-top-style: dotted;
	border-top-color: #347F9E;
}

.line_b {
	border-top-width: 1px;
	border-top-style: dotted;
	border-top-color: #2B3175;
}

.line_a {
	border-top-width: 1px;
	border-top-style: dotted;
	border-top-color: #D32C32;
}
.line_c {
	border-top-width: 1px;
	border-top-style: dotted;
	border-top-color: #BA3981;
}

a:active {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	color: #333333;
	text-decoration: none;
}
.header {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 14px;
	font-style: normal;
	font-weight: bold;
	color: #333333;
	text-align: center;
	padding-bottom: 10px;

}
.header1 {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 12px;
	font-style: normal;
	font-weight: bold;
	color: #333333;
	padding-bottom: 10px;
	vertical-align: 0.5em;
}
.header2 {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 12px;
	font-style: normal;
	font-weight: bold;
	color: #333333;
	padding-bottom: 15px
}
.header3 {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 13px;
	font-style: normal;
	font-weight: normal;
	color: #333333;
	padding-bottom: 10px
}
.button {
	background-color: #FFFFFF;
	border-top-style: none;
	border-right-style: none;
	border-bottom-style: none;
	border-left-style: none;
}
.button_l {
	background-color: #FFFFFF;
	border-top-style: none;
	border-right-style: none;
	border-bottom-style: none;
	border-left-style: none;
	right: 0px;
}
.button_r {
	background-color: #FFFFFF;
	border-top-style: none;
	border-right-style: none;
	border-bottom-style: none;
	border-left-style: none;
	left: 0px;
}
.bgcolor {
	background-color: #0A2552;
}
.white {
	background-color: #FFFFFF;
}
.image {
	left: 0px;
	padding-top: 30px;
	right: 10px;
	bottom: 10px;
}
.image1 {
	left: 0px;
	padding-top: 15px;
	padding-right: 20px;
	padding-bottom: 15px;
}
.image2 {
	left: 0px;
	padding-top: 10px;
	padding-left: 15px;
	padding-bottom: 15px;
	bottom: 10px;
}
.image3 {
	left: 0px;
	top: 10px;
	padding-right: 15px;
	padding-bottom: 50px;
}
.image4 {
	
	padding-top: 20px;
	padding-left: 30px;
	padding-right: 10px;
	
}
.image5 {
	
	padding-top: 10px;
	padding-left: 20px;
	padding-right: 20px;
	padding-bottom: 3px;
}
.image6 {
	
	padding-top: 5px;
	padding-right: 15px;
	padding-bottom: 5px;
}
.image7 {
	padding-top: 20px;
	padding-left: 15px;
	padding-bottom: 20px;
}
.image8 {
	padding-top: 5px;
	padding-left: 15px;
	padding-bottom: 5px;
}
.image9 {
	padding-top: 15px;
	padding-left: 25px;
	padding-bottom: 15px;
}
.list {
	padding-bottom: 10px;
}
.box {
	border: thin dotted #333333;
	padding: 20px;
}
.footer {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 9px;
	color: #333333;
}
.boxed {
	padding: 2px;
	border: thin dotted #666666;
}
.boxed_ {
	border: thin dotted #003366;
	padding: 2px;
}
.boxed_about {
	border: thin dotted #d32c32;
	padding: 2px;
}
.boxed_contact {
	border: thin dotted #ba3981;
	padding: 2px;
}
.boxed_private {
	border: thin dotted #d56145;
	padding: 2px;
}
.boxed_workshops {
	border: thin dotted #287441;
	padding: 2px;
}
.boxed_spinal {
	border: thin dotted #c6ca47;
	padding: 2px;
}
.boxed_touch {
	border: thin dotted #347f9e;
	padding: 2px;
}
.boxed_articles {
	border: thin dotted #2b3175;
	padding: 2px;	
}
.boxed_test {
	 
	top-border:1px dotted #d32c32; 
	height:0px;
	padding: 2px;
}

.click_here {
	vertical-align: -0.5em;	
	
}
.sub {

	vertical-align: 0.5em;
	
}
